Zelda Ocarina of Time in Unreal Engine 4 – New build featuring 4 maps + Hyrule Field is available for download

Zelda fans, here is something special for you today. CryZENx has released some new maps from his Zelda Ocarina of Time project in Unreal Engine 4. CryZENx’s project will give you an idea of what a Zelda game could look like in Unreal Engine 4, so we strongly suggest downloading it (if you are fans of Zelda games).

This time, CryZENx released four new maps from his project, as well as a recreated map from the Hyrule Field.

Zelda Ocarina of Time in Unreal Engine 4 lets you control Link and explore the recreated environments in Unreal Engine 4. This project also sports some combat mechanics as players will be able to fight enemies.

Naturally, this is mostly a tech demo and nothing more, however it is free stuff so we’re pretty sure that a lot of gamers will be intrigued to at least give it a go.
